How Westwego's Climate and Soil Shape Your Yard
Our local conditions directly affect your landscaping needs. Westwego has a subtropical climate with long, hot summers and mild, wet winters. The soil is often heavy clay, which holds water and can lead to drainage issues. Salt spray from nearby waterways can also affect certain plants.
Housing styles vary from older neighborhoods with giant, mature live oaks to newer developments with smaller lots. Homes near the river or in lower-lying areas off Avenue A are more prone to standing water. No matter your home type, choosing the right plants and proper drainage is key.

Understanding Costs for Landscaping in Westwego
Landscaping costs depend on the job's size, materials, and urgency. Here’s a transparent breakdown based on local averages:
- Emergency Call-Out: After-hours or urgent response often includes a premium fee, typically ranging from $75 to $200, on top of labor costs.
- Labor: Many services charge by the hour. Rates for landscaping labor in the Greater New Orleans area, including Westwego, average between $50 and $100 per hour per worker, depending on the job's complexity.
- Materials: Sod, plants, mulch, and stone are extra. For example, sod costs $0.30-$0.80 per square foot, and delivery fees may apply.
- Equipment: Jobs needing chippers, stump grinders, or cranes have added fees.
- Disposal: Hauling away green waste or old materials usually costs extra.
Here are some example scenarios with likely cost ranges:
- Emergency Fallen Small Tree Removal: For a crew to cut up and chip a medium tree down in your yard: $200 – $800.
- Large Tree Removal with Crane: For a big tree near a structure needing a crane and possibly a permit: $1,200 – $5,000+.
- Drainage Correction (French Drain): To fix a chronically wet area: $1,000 – $4,000, depending on length and depth.
- New Sod Installation: For an average-sized Westwego yard: $1,000 – $3,000 for materials and labor.
- Irrigation Repair: A service call to diagnose the issue is often $75-$150. The repair itself can range from $100 for a simple sprinkler head to $800+ for main line work.
Emergency visits cost more due to overtime pay, rapid mobilization, and sometimes special equipment rentals.

Safety Checklist Before Help Arrives
If you have a landscaping emergency, follow these steps:
- Keep all people and pets away from the hazard zone.
- If you see downed power lines, stay back and call Entergy Louisiana immediately.
- Take photos of the damage for your insurance.
- Move vehicles away from fallen trees or flood areas.
- If a broken irrigation line is flooding the yard, shut off the water at the main valve.
- Secure any loose patio furniture or yard items if high winds continue.
- Important: Do not try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. Always call 811 at least two business days before any digging project.
Local Permits and Rules You Should Know
Some landscaping work in Westwego requires permits. Always check with the City of Westwego or Jefferson Parish for the latest rules. Common requirements include:
- Tree Removal Permits: May be needed for removing large or protected trees, especially in historic areas.
- Grading/Drainage Permits: Often required for significant earth-moving or work near waterways.
- HOA Rules: If you live in a subdivision or condo, check your HOA rules before making visible changes.
- Construction Permits: Usually needed for substantial retaining walls, new patios over a certain size, or commercial landscaping projects.
